Harwich Center and Orleans are places in Massachusetts.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Harwich Center has the higher population (1,620 vs 1,618 in Orleans). Harwich Center has the higher median household income ($76,944 vs $76,768 in Orleans). Harwich Center has the higher median home value ($546,600 vs $542,500 in Orleans).
